About this home
The McDowell at Windsor Station is a two-story, four-bedroom, three-and-a-half-bath home with a first-floor primary bedroom, formal dining room, two-story family room, kitchen with an island and pantry, and a separate breakfast area. The second floor features three spacious bedrooms and two additional baths, including a Jack-and-Jill bath between bedrooms two and three, an oversized open loft area, and an unfinished…

WINDSOR STATION and the Windsor real estate market
Windsor Station sits in the town of Windsor, Virginia — a small but steadily growing community in Isle of Wight County that draws people who want breathing room without sacrificing convenience. Windsor itself has a genuine small-town character: tree-lined streets, a walkable core, and neighbors who actually wave. The Windsor Station neighborhood fits right into that identity, offering newer construction homes in a setting that feels more like a classic Virginia town than a sprawling suburb. Windsor is positioned along the US-460 corridor, which connects you westward toward Suffolk and eastward toward the broader Hampton Roads metro without the congestion you'd find closer to the coast. Isle of Wight County is known for its lower-density feel and strong sense of community pride.
